September Full Moon Rituals: Harvest Moon Energy Work

The Harvest Moon is one of the most enchanting full moons of the year, casting its golden light across fields, orchards, and forests. Occurring closest to the autumn equinox, it is a moon of abundance, gratitude, and illumination. For centuries, its glow guided farmers through late-night harvests, and for witches, it continues to shine as a beacon of balance and prosperity. Working with the Harvest Moon allows us to connect to cycles of growth, honor what we have gathered in both physical and spiritual realms, and release what no longer serves us as we move toward the darker months of the year.

The Magic of the Harvest Moon

This full moon carries a particular brilliance, often appearing larger and more luminous than others due to its low position on the horizon. Its light seems to stretch longer into the night, making it ideal for magical work that requires clarity and illumination. Energetically, the Harvest Moon is a time of reaping rewards, expressing gratitude, and aligning with the natural cycles of giving and receiving.

“The Harvest Moon does not simply light the sky; it lights the path toward gratitude and abundance.”

When working with this moon, focus on themes of:

  • Abundance and prosperity

  • Gratitude for what has been achieved

  • Releasing what is no longer fruitful

  • Balance and preparation for the season ahead

Preparing for a Harvest Moon Ritual

Before working with the Harvest Moon’s energy, create sacred space. This can be outdoors under its glow or indoors with candles and symbolic items. Cleanse your space with smoke from sage, rosemary, or cedar, or sprinkle saltwater around the area. Gather items that align with the season: apples, grains, pumpkins, autumn leaves, or crystals such as citrine, smoky quartz, and carnelian.

A Harvest Moon altar may include:

  • A bowl of fresh or dried herbs from your garden

  • A candle in shades of gold or orange

  • Crystals that represent abundance and grounding

  • A handwritten note of gratitude to be burned or buried later

Harvest Moon Gratitude Spell

This spell draws the energy of abundance into your life and amplifies your gratitude for what has already been received.

You will need:

  • A gold or orange candle

  • A small bowl of apples or seeds

  • A piece of paper and pen

Steps:

  1. Light the candle and place the bowl of apples or seeds before you.

  2. Write down five things you are grateful for from the past season.

  3. Hold the paper in your hands and say:
    “Moon of harvest, bright and near,
    Shine on blessings I hold dear.
    With open heart, I welcome more,
    Abundance flows to every door.”

  4. Burn the paper safely or bury it in the earth, symbolizing your gratitude feeding future growth.

Releasing Under the Harvest Moon

The Harvest Moon is also a time of letting go, clearing space for the new season’s work. Release rituals are particularly potent when the full moon shines bright.

Harvest Moon Release Ritual:

  • Write down what you wish to release—habits, fears, or lingering doubts.

  • Place the paper under the light of the moon.

  • Tear it into small pieces, casting them into the wind or burying them in the earth, saying:
    “With this moon, I release and renew,
    Making space for what is true.”

This act ensures you step into autumn unburdened and aligned with your higher path.

Moonlight Charging and Energy Work

Use the Harvest Moon’s light to charge magical tools and crystals. Lay them out under the moon overnight, allowing them to soak in its golden glow. This is also an excellent time for energy cleansing. Stand in the moonlight with arms outstretched and imagine its light filling you, washing away stagnant energy, and recharging your spirit.

Simple practices for moonlight work:

  • Leave a jar of water outside to create Harvest Moon water, perfect for anointing tools or sprinkling around your altar.

  • Meditate under the moonlight, focusing on your breath and visualizing yourself absorbing abundance.

  • Place tarot cards, runes, or pendulums beneath the moon to cleanse and amplify their energy.

Harvest Moon Journaling Prompts

Journaling is a powerful way to align with the full moon’s energy. Take time to reflect on the following prompts:

  • What am I most grateful for in this season of my life?

  • Where have I seen growth, and where am I still seeking harvest?

  • What fears or doubts do I wish to leave behind with this moon?

  • How can I honor the balance of light and dark as autumn deepens?

Writing beneath the Harvest Moon or immediately afterward captures the clarity that this energy brings.

A Communal Ritual of Sharing

The Harvest Moon is also a time of gathering and community. If possible, invite friends or fellow witches to share a ritual meal under the moonlight. Each person can bring an offering—bread, fruit, or herbs—and contribute gratitude aloud before eating together. This creates a circle of abundance, strengthening both magical and human connections.

Ideas for a Harvest Moon feast:

  • Freshly baked bread symbolizing prosperity

  • Apples dipped in honey for sweetness in the months ahead

  • A hearty vegetable stew, honoring the gifts of the harvest

  • Herbal teas infused with cinnamon or chamomile for warmth and calm

Gathering in this way weaves community energy into your ritual practice, magnifying the blessings of the Harvest Moon.

The Harvest Moon reminds us that cycles of effort bear fruit and that gratitude paves the way for future abundance. Its glow is a gentle teacher, guiding us to harvest what we have grown, share what we can, and release what must be left behind. When we honor this moon with spells, rituals, and heartfelt gratitude, we step into autumn aligned, renewed, and filled with quiet magic.
